Output 84931616e451d2a2122643b58fcd0fb59baaab66ab4e8824a157984302832066:1

value
1557883
script pubkey
OP_0 OP_PUSHBYTES_32 ddedb93ccd4fe727772bfee47525a28877bd45e5614df14ff6985f2b66e95639
address
bc1qmhkmj0xdflnjwaetlmj82fdz3pmm6309v9xlznlknp0jkehf2cuspdmjs8
transaction
84931616e451d2a2122643b58fcd0fb59baaab66ab4e8824a157984302832066
spent
true